Mandola’s Italian Kitchen Announces Odessa Outpost as Part of Larger Expansion

Helmed by Chef Damian Mandola, Odessa will be the newest outpost following next week’s Oldsmar opening.

In a press release issued Sep 12, Mandola’s Italian Kitchen announced the opening of two new locations in the Tampa market – one in Oldsmar that’s slated to open next Monday, Sep 19, followed by an Odessa outpost located at 16080 Preserve Marketplace Blvd., which will launch early next year.

The Odessa storefront will join Organic Nail Bar, Publix GreenWise Market, and more in the newly constructed Preserve Marketplace lifestyle hub, serving as the company’s “first free-standing restaurant…[and] embodying the delicious Italian experience that has made the brand famous.”

A representative of Mandola’s Italian Kitchen was not immediately available for comment. 

In a statement, owner and executive Chef Damian Mandola said, “We look forward to expanding further into the Tampa region and bringing our signature food, hospitality, and experience to the wonderful communities of Oldsmar and Odessa. There is nothing quite like Mandola’s Italian Kitchen and its unique, comfortable atmosphere and fresh, high-quality Italian food, using the recipes that have been in my family for generations.”

Mandola’s Italian Kitchen was opened in Austin, TX in 2006 by Damian and wife Trina. Since then, the couple has opened five more locations throughout Texas and Florida, with two others opening soon in Jacksonville and Orlando.
